Handover note — GlimmerWiki RBAC

I'm passing the role-based access module to you. Permissions are evaluated top-down: group rules first, then page-level overrides. Never edit the admin group directly in the database; use the management console. Pending work: audit logging for role changes is half-finished on the feature branch. Questions about policy decisions should go to the owner listed below.

account owner for fajep-yagef: Kasix Eliiel

The Routewell dispatch engine scores each candidate driver using weighted proximity, shift remaining, and vehicle class compatibility. Plugin authors may override individual weights via the `heuristic.overrides` object, but the final score is always normalized by the Routewell core before assignment. Note that calls to the scoring endpoint are rate-limited per tenant, and retries must use exponential backoff. To authenticate your plugin against the sandbox scoring service, include the key shown below in every request header.

gateway credential: kto3_qfe

The garage occupancy feed for the Brindlewood campus arrives over a message queue every thirty seconds, one record per level, published by the Stallgrid edge boxes. Counts can briefly go negative when a sensor double-fires on exit; the ingest job clamps these to zero and flags the interval. If the feed stalls for more than five minutes, the dashboard falls back to the last known snapshot. Sensor mappings, queue names, and the replay procedure are documented on the internal page below.

runbook for tahog-kadug: https://gitlab.qirvanworks.corp/projects/pages/view/b139298aed28

Handover Note — Sale of the Brightlock Components Unit

To the finance team: I am passing responsibility for the Brightlock divestiture to Director Mira Tennant. Purchase agreement terms are final, escrow arrangements confirmed, and the closing balance sheet is due in three weeks. Continue booking transition-service revenue to the designated ledger. Mira will brief you on what comes after the sale.

board note of baweg-bawig: Project Tamath slips by six weeks because of the audit delay.